Fitbit UX Researcher Salaries in Boston

The average Fitbit UX Researcher in Boston earns $122,500 annually, which includes a base salary of $117,500 with a $5,000 bonus. This total compensation is $26,103 more than the US average for a UX Researcher. UX Researcher salaries at Fitbit in Boston can range from $115,000 - $125,000.

In Boston, The Design Department at Fitbit earns $15,552 more on average than the Business Development Department.

UX Researcher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female UX Researcher at companies similar size to Fitbit reported making $102,788, while the average male UX Researcher at similar sized companies reported making $101,646.

UX Researcher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Hispanic or Latino UX Researcher at companies similar size to Fitbit reported making $109,625, while the average Caucasian UX Researcher at similar sized companies reported making $94,559.
